Transaction e52ebba869d59825302c26e42e18163384a5391b99d2f82f26af59483ec617a1
1 Input
1 Output
-
e52ebba869d59825302c26e42e18163384a5391b99d2f82f26af59483ec617a1:0
- value
- 874962
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6fbb1580cbafbd876af060900c152ee1da023e74 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BBn87o4G4LqsFweCq69aH3mKWUH6wfxxo